What makes a multi-complex exact?

Abstract

In this paper, we give a sufficient condition which makes the total complex of a cube exact. This can be regarded as a variant of the Buchsbaum-Eisenbud theorem which gives a characterization of what makes a complex of finitely generated free modules exact in terms of the grade of the Fitting ideals of boundary maps of the complex.
